Virtual Showrooms: Bringing the Dealership to Your Living Room

Virtual reality allows shoppers to experience a vehicle without setting foot on a dealership lot. Through a VR headset or even a simple web-based platform, potential buyers can “enter” a digital showroom and explore a full 360-degree view of a vehicle’s interior and exterior. You can open doors, peek inside the trunk, examine dashboard details, and even “sit” in the driver’s seat—all from the comfort of your own home.

This kind of interaction saves time and gives buyers the freedom to explore multiple options before deciding which vehicles are worth seeing in person. For busy families or individuals comparing different body styles and features, a virtual showroom can streamline the research process significantly.

Augmented Reality: Your Next Car in Your Driveway

While virtual reality creates a fully digital environment, augmented reality takes the real world and adds digital layers on top of it. Using a smartphone or tablet, car shoppers can project a life-sized, 3D model of a vehicle right onto their driveway or parking space.

Want to see how a specific vehicle would look parked in front of your house? AR makes that possible. You can walk around the car, change the color, view different trim levels, or test how much garage space it might occupy. This hands-on, visual context is particularly helpful for those evaluating the fit, size, or styling of a vehicle relative to their everyday environment.

Decoding Your Vehicle’s Warranty: A Beginner’s Guide

When you purchase a new or used vehicle, one of the most important aspects to consider is the warranty that comes with it. Understanding the ins and outs of your car warranty can save you time, money, and hassle down the road. In this beginner’s guide, we will break down everything you need to know about car warranties to help you make the most of your coverage.

What is a Car Warranty?

A car warranty is a contract between the vehicle owner and the manufacturer or dealership that provides coverage for certain repairs and services within a specific timeframe. Warranties are designed to protect you from unexpected expenses that may arise due to mechanical failures or defects in the vehicle.

Types of Car Warranties

  • Powertrain Warranty: Covers the engine, transmission, and drivetrain components.
  • Bumper-to-Bumper Warranty: Provides comprehensive coverage for most vehicle systems.
  • Extended Warranty: Additional coverage purchased separately from the manufacturer’s warranty.

What is Covered by a Car Warranty?

Car warranties typically cover the cost of parts and labor for repairs related to mechanical failures or defects. Common components and services covered include:

  • Engine repairs
  • Transmission repairs
  • Electrical system repairs
  • Air conditioning system repairs
  • Brake system repairs

Understanding Warranty Terms and Conditions

When reading through your car warranty, pay attention to common terms and conditions such as:

  • Deductible: The amount you are responsible for paying towards repairs.
  • Coverage Limits: Maximum amount the warranty will pay for each repair.
  • Exclusions: Parts or services not covered by the warranty.

Warranty Extension and Transferability

Some warranties can be extended for an additional cost, providing coverage beyond the original terms. Additionally, some warranties are transferable to a new owner if you sell the vehicle within the warranty period.

From Classic to Modern: How Retro Design is Influencing Today’s Cars

The automotive world is experiencing a fascinating trend—the return of retro design in modern vehicles. While today’s cars are packed with cutting-edge technology, automakers are increasingly borrowing styling cues from classic models to evoke nostalgia while delivering modern performance and convenience. From sleek body lines to vintage-inspired grilles, the influence of timeless designs is making a strong comeback, proving that great style never goes out of fashion.

A Nod to the Past with Modern Innovation

Many of today’s most exciting vehicles seamlessly blend classic aesthetics with advanced engineering. Retro-styled headlights, bold front grilles, and signature body shapes reminiscent of past eras are reappearing on the roads. Yet, underneath these familiar exteriors, modern vehicles house sophisticated technology such as digital dashboards, hybrid powertrains, and self-driving features.

This combination of old and new allows drivers to enjoy the timeless appeal of classic cars without sacrificing safety, fuel efficiency, or comfort. Whether it’s a sleek luxury sedan inspired by the elegant cruisers of the past or a rugged SUV drawing from legendary off-road vehicles, manufacturers are finding ways to honor automotive heritage while meeting today’s driving needs.

The Return of Iconic Design Elements

One of the most striking trends in retro-inspired cars is the reintroduction of bold and timeless design cues that defined previous decades. Modern vehicles are increasingly featuring:

  • Boxy silhouettes and streamlined curves reminiscent of vintage luxury sedans and muscle cars.
  • Chrome accents and vertical grilles that pay homage to mid-century automotive elegance.
  • Retro color palettes, including deep blues, vibrant reds, and classic whites, that bring a sense of nostalgia to the modern showroom.

These details don’t just make cars more visually appealing—they connect generations of drivers, allowing enthusiasts to relive the golden age of automobiles with a modern twist.

Technology That Complements the Retro Revival

While these vehicles might look like they belong to a different era, they are anything but outdated. Today’s retro-inspired cars come equipped with:

  • Advanced driver assistance systems, including automatic braking and lane-keeping assistance.
  • Touchscreen infotainment that integrates seamlessly with classic dashboard layouts.
  • Hybrid and electric powertrains that bring efficiency to legendary designs.

This balance of past and present allows drivers to enjoy the aesthetics of a bygone era without compromising on safety, connectivity, or fuel economy.

High-Tech Parking: Cars That Take the Stress Out of Tight Spaces

Parking in crowded city streets or tight parking garages can be one of the most frustrating aspects of driving. Fortunately, automotive technology has advanced significantly, bringing self-parking systems, 360-degree cameras, and automated steering to modern vehicles. These features take the stress out of parallel parking, tight spots, and tricky maneuvers, making city driving easier and more enjoyable than ever.

Smart Parking Assistance: Let Your Car Do the Work

Gone are the days of multiple failed attempts at squeezing into a parking space. Many modern vehicles now come equipped with self-parking systems, using advanced sensors and cameras to analyze available parking spots and automatically steer into them. The driver only needs to control braking and acceleration while the system precisely guides the vehicle into place.

These systems are particularly helpful in urban settings where parking spots are limited, reducing the need for extensive maneuvering and minimizing the risk of scraping curbs or bumping into other cars. Whether parallel parking on a busy street or fitting into a tight shopping center space, smart parking assistance makes the process effortless.

360-Degree Cameras: A Complete View of Your Surroundings

A major challenge when parking is the limited visibility of obstacles around your vehicle. 360-degree camera systems solve this issue by providing a bird’s-eye view of the car and its surroundings. This technology uses multiple cameras placed around the vehicle, stitching together a complete image on the infotainment screen.

This feature is especially useful for tight parking lots, narrow alleyways, and avoiding obstacles like bicycles, curbs, or poles. It not only enhances convenience but also significantly improves safety by reducing blind spots and ensuring a clear view of potential hazards.

Automated Steering and Sensors: Precision at Your Fingertips

For drivers who still prefer to park manually but want extra assistance, automated steering and parking sensors offer a perfect balance. Advanced sensors detect the distance between the vehicle and nearby objects, providing audible or visual warnings when getting too close.

Some luxury vehicles even feature steering assist, which helps guide the vehicle with minimal input from the driver, making parking smoother and more precise. These systems eliminate the need to constantly adjust the wheel while backing in, ensuring a perfect alignment with the parking space.

Adventure vs. Luxury: How to Decide Between an SUV and a Sedan

When it comes to choosing between an SUV and a sedan, the decision often comes down to your lifestyle, driving preferences, and what you value most in a vehicle. At AutoDealz, we understand that every driver is unique, and so are their needs on the road. Whether you’re an adventure-seeker looking for rugged capability or someone who values sleek luxury and fuel efficiency, this guide will help you make an informed decision.

Driving Experience: Rugged Exploration vs. Refined Comfort

An SUV is the ultimate choice for those who crave adventure and flexibility. With a higher ground clearance, advanced all-wheel-drive systems, and robust construction, SUVs excel on rough terrains and offer peace of mind in adverse weather conditions. Whether you’re heading to the mountains for a weekend hike or navigating icy winter roads, an SUV provides the confidence and capability you need.

On the other hand, sedans offer a smooth, controlled driving experience that feels elegant and refined. Their lower profile makes them easier to maneuver in tight city spaces, and they typically offer better fuel efficiency. Sedans shine on long highway drives, where their aerodynamic design and stable handling provide unmatched comfort.

Consider This: If your weekends involve off-road trails and unpredictable terrains, an SUV might be your best companion. However, if you prefer effortless commutes and polished city driving, a sedan might be the perfect choice.

Interior Space: Versatility vs. Sophistication

When it comes to space, SUVs lead the way with their roomy interiors and flexible seating configurations. With foldable rear seats and generous cargo areas, SUVs are perfect for families, road trips, or carrying larger items like camping gear, bicycles, or strollers. They offer a commanding driving position, which many drivers find reassuring.

On the other hand, sedans prioritize refined interiors and driver-focused comfort. While they may not have the expansive cargo space of SUVs, sedans often feature luxurious seating, sleek dashboards, and quieter cabins. They’re perfect for professionals and those who value a clean, minimalist space.

Consider This: If versatility and cargo space are your priorities, an SUV will provide the flexibility you need. But if you appreciate sleek interiors and refined finishes, a sedan might better suit your style.

Fuel Efficiency: Long Drives vs. Daily Savings

Fuel efficiency is another critical factor when choosing between an SUV and a sedan. In general, sedans are more fuel-efficient due to their lighter weight and streamlined design. For daily commuters who spend a lot of time in city traffic, a sedan can lead to significant savings at the pump.

SUVs, while improving in fuel efficiency with modern hybrid and turbocharged engines, tend to consume more fuel due to their size and weight. However, they offer added value with towing capabilities and all-weather adaptability.

Consider This: If you’re focused on long-term savings and frequent city driving, a sedan is the way to go. If your lifestyle involves outdoor adventures, off-road driving, or hauling cargo, the fuel trade-off for an SUV might be well worth it.

Safety and Technology: Modern Features for Every Driver

Both SUVs and sedans have advanced significantly in terms of safety and technology. SUVs often come equipped with off-road driving aids, hill-descent control, and advanced driver-assistance systems designed for all terrains. Their larger build also provides an added sense of security in the event of a collision.

Sedans, meanwhile, focus on lane-keeping assistance, adaptive cruise control, and city-driving safety features. They also tend to offer more responsive handling, making them easier to control in tight traffic situations.

Consider This: Both SUVs and sedans offer excellent safety technology. The difference lies in whether you need those features for urban driving or rugged off-road conditions.
